RE: Easton Axis Arrows.....
The Axis is a good arrow. Straightness is .005 and =/- 2 grains per dozen....So not the tightest tolerances in the industry, but they are very rugged, provide excellent penetration, and fly very well.
Overall, on a scale of 1-10 I would give them a 7.5.....I personally think they are overpriced for the tolerances, but that's just me and if you can get them at a good price, you wouldn't be hurting yourself any. |
